A force of 5 units acts on a particle in the direction to the east and another force of 4 units acts on the particle in the direction north-east. The resultants of the two forces is

a

\(\sqrt{3}\) units

b

3 units

c

\(\sqrt{41 + 20 \sqrt{2}}\) units

d

\(\sqrt{41 - 20 \sqrt{2}}\) units
